The two artists are coming together after over 20 years for Avatar 2.” According to a report by Den of Geek, Winslet has officially been confirmed as being involved in the making of “Avatar’s” future installments.

Cameron is going to be making “Avatar 2" and "Avatar 3” together. Success on those films could lead to the quick production of parts four and five.

Cast and crew members of the 'Avatar' series

Winslet is not the only addition that Cameron has made to his “Avatar” team. Seven other “young” artists have also been recruited to play different roles for the movie. “Avatar” was released back in 2009 and the science-fiction movie still remains the highest grossing film of all time. The cast and crew members of “Avatar 2” began shooting for the new film on September 25. If rumors turn out to be true, then the movie is set to debut on December 18, 2020. It will be followed up by “Avatar 3,” in 2021 and “Avatar 4,” in 2024.

The last and the final installment of the film franchise will be released in 2025. Cameron has big plans for the “Avatar” franchise. The known faces – Sam Worthington and Zoe Saldana -- will return as protagonists in the next movie. Their romance will continue to flourish in the series in the form of Sully and Neytiri.

They will probably end up having two children by the time “Avatar” concludes. Another surprising returning character is the one played by Sigourney Weaver. Interestingly, her character was killed off in the first “Avatar” movie. In an interview with Screen Rant, the actress said that she will be playing a new character. At the same time, Cameron said he is planning on bringing Weaver’s original character back to the series.

He is still apparently working on how he will manage to do that.
